CLing.omy.sg – a new web portal to learn Chinese and understand modern China
Today, omy.sg launched a new web portal together with Business China at Dragonfly, St. James Power Station. The event was graced by Prime Minister Lee Hsien Loong. Other than the launch of CLing ( http://cling.omy.sg ), there was a youth … Continue reading
